After a long wait from play.com I finally got this album 'Backstreet BritFunk'
If you want to hear some classic late 70's/early 80's funk from some of the unknown but finest funksters from the UK at that time then check this CD out.
It has some of that early slap bass playing that is totally 80's as well as some great dance funk tunes.
It's on ZR records ZeddCD0018 and here is the website link
